ORA-38708: not enough space for first flashback database log
file
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/ guest
Cause: An ALTER DATABASE FLASHBACK ON command failed because
there was not enough space in the Recovery Area for the
first flashback database log file.
Action: Make more space in the Recovery Area. For example,
this can be done by increasing the value of
DB_RECOVERY_FILE_DEST_SIZE.
